§ 304.9 Placards; display of regulations. Every dealer offering for sale silver bearing the Government mark may display in a prominent place a placard setting forth the standards and the regulations in this part, such placard to be furnished by the Indian Arts and Crafts Board. [Regs., Apr. 2, 1937, as amended Feb. 21, 1938]
